The Fortress Volunteer Team has partnered with the Hong Kong Federation of Youth Groups to host a "Cross-Generation Wellbeing Day" to visit elderly people in To Kwa Wan. To help the elders maintain good health despite the epidemic, volunteers played games and shared some stretching tips with them. A Fortress rice cooker and electric kettle were also given to every elderly, as a token of love and care.

To drive sustainable living, Fortress & Caritas Computer Workshop (CCW) jointly launched the market-first Laptop Transformation Programme. Customers can recycle laptops at Fortress, and CCW will help to disinfect the laptops and install basic software, helping to reduce electronic waste and foster social integration. Fortress successfully collected 300 laptops in the 3-month pilot scheme, helping those in need and achieving Fortress’ social purpose – Living Better Together.
